Moldy pork chops and contaminated chicken. 7 restaurants ordered shut!

This week’s Dirty Dining takes us to North Miami Beach, Oakland Park, Sunrise, North Lauderdale, Pompano Beach and Cutler Bay, where seven restaurants were temporarily ordered shut by state inspectors.

Among the violations: mold growing on food, cooked chicken contaminated by flies, rodent and roach activity, food kept at unsafe temperatures, mold-like buildup inside an ice machine, unsanitary kitchen conditions, and one business operating without running water.

No restaurants in the Florida Keys were ordered shut last week. All of the establishments later reopened after an ordered cleanup and passing a follow-up inspection…
